Oyster Sauce Beef
Ingredients: beef flank, water, oyster sauce, light soy sauce, cornstarch · 45 min cook time · 450kcal · ~₩17,830
Ingredients
310g beef flank, 1cup water, 1.5tbsp oyster sauce, 2tsp light soy sauce, 2tbsp cornstarch, 3tbsp water, 0.25tsp white pepper, 0.5tsp baking soda, 1tbsp oil, 0.5tbsp dark soy sauce, 1tsp sugar, 0.5tsp potato starch, 1tbsp water, 2tbsp oil, 1oz ginger, 56g snow peas, 70g celery, 85g seafood mushrooms, 85g button mushrooms, 56g carrot, 2stalks green onions, 2cloves garlic
Instructions
1. Cut 11 oz (about 310g) of beef flank. If the beef is thick, halve it first. Slice perpendicular to the grain, not too thick or too thin. Slightly frozen meat is easier to cut.
2. Transfer sliced beef to a bowl. Add water and gently rinse to remove freezer odors and myoglobin. Squeeze gently and set aside.
3. Prepare the beef marinade: combine 1 tbsp oyster sauce, 2 tsp light soy sauce, 2 tbsp cornstarch, 3 tbsp water, 1/4 tsp white pepper, and 1/2 tsp baking soda. Mix well.
4. After soaking the beef for 2-3 minutes, drain and squeeze out the water. This helps the beef absorb seasoning and makes it smoother and more tender.
5. Add the squeezed beef to the marinade and mix well, preferably by hand, squeezing as you mix. Let it marinate.
6. Prepare vegetables: destring 2 oz (about 56g) snow peas. Cut 2-3 oz (about 56-85g) celery into strips. Trim ends of a whole package (about 3 oz / 85g) seafood mushrooms and rinse. Trim dark ends of 3 oz (about 85g) button mushrooms and cut into three pieces. Cut shallow notches around 2 oz (about 56g) carrot for a flower pattern, then slice.
7. Prepare aromatics: thinly slice the bulbs (white parts) of green onions and cut into 1-inch segments. Keep the green parts separate for later. Smash, peel, trim ends, and slice 2 cloves of garlic. Trim peel and slice roughly 1 oz (about 28g) ginger.
8. Prepare the stir-fry sauce: combine 1/2 tbsp oyster sauce, 1/2 tbsp dark soy sauce, and 1 tsp sugar. Mix together.
9. Prepare the slurry: in a separate bowl, mix 1/2 tsp potato starch and 1 tbsp water.
10. Add 1 tbsp of oil to the marinated beef and mix well. This helps seal juices and separate the beef during cooking.
11. Heat a wok on high heat until the center turns pale and it begins to smoke. Lower heat to medium. Add 2 tbsp of oil and bring it up the sides of the wok. Add two slices of ginger to the oil.
12. Add the beef to the hot oil. Spread it out gently without flipping. Cook on medium heat, then turn up to high. Cook 80% of the way through for 30-40 seconds, then flip. After another 20-30 seconds, turn off the heat.
13. Scoop out the cooked beef and place it in a bowl. This process, along with the marinade, is called velveting, resulting in silky meat.
14. With the wok still containing oil, set to medium heat. Add garlic, ginger, and green onion bulbs. Stir-fry for 30-40 seconds until aromatic.
15. Add button mushrooms and stir-fry for 30-40 seconds to bring out their aroma.
16. Add celery and carrot. Cook for 20-30 seconds.
17. Add snow peas and seafood mushrooms. Stir-fry everything together.
